Analysis

Annex I countries recorded 996.96 million kg for chickens, broilers — manure applied to soils in 2023.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 3.5% on the previous year and down 1.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, chickens, broilers — manure applied to soils in Annex I countries peaked at 1.11 billion kg in 2020 and was at its lowest, 387.20 million kg, in 1961.

Annex I countries ranks 5th of 37 groups on this measure, in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
